--- AnyEvent/Changes 2009/11/19 01:55:57 1.357 +++ AnyEvent/Changes 2009/12/16 01:22:35 1.372 @@ -1,5 +1,25 @@ Revision history for Perl extension AnyEvent. + - support IDNs in resolve_sockaddr, and therefore in tcp_connect. + - provide $AE::VERSION. + - removed traces of "no strict 'refs'". + - implement punycode_encode/decode, idn_nameprep, + idn_to_ascii and idn_to_unicode operations in AnyEvent::Util. + +5.22 Sat Dec 5 03:51:13 CET 2009 + - downgrade-or-fail in AnyEvent::Handle::push_write, to + diagnose encoding failures earlier and more succinctly. + (this works around bugs in perl, throwing away encoding info + when passing scalar data to extensions). + - add more examples to AnyEvent::Socket manpage. + - upgrade internal warning set to the same as common::sense 2.03. + - use pack "n/a*" for pre-5.8.9 perl compatibility in AnyEvent::DNS + (John Beppu). + - AnyEvent::Socket::inet_aton now properly supports ipv6, as documented. + - add google public dns servers to fallback server set and make sure + we load-balance properly between the three sets. also add all + fallback dns servers, not just a random one, to each dns config. + 5.21 Thu Nov 19 02:48:47 CET 2009 - fix a problem where socket constants were called with parameters (spotted by David Friedland).